Keysight Donates EEsof EDA Software to South Korean University

Keysight ADSKeysight Technologies has announced its donation of Keysight EDA software to Chungnam National University (CNU) in Daejeon, South Korea, as part of the Keysight EEsof EDA University Educational Support Program. This is the third software donation this year, following earlier donations to South Korea’s Sogang and Dongguk Universities, and is intended to help CNU foster well-rounded electronics engineering experts. This enables quicker advancement in research efforts and teaches the critical skillset needed to positively impact industry.

Keysight EDA’s donation to CNU was formally announced during a ceremony at CNU on 18th August. The donation comprises three licenses of Keysight EMPro 3-D electromagnetic (EM) simulation and analysis software. In return for the donation, CNU agrees to develop RF and microwave research projects (e.g., advanced RF microwave components) using circuit-3D EM co-simulation. CNU will also use the software for academic purposes, and to create technical papers, examples and webcasts.

CNU recently released a microwave circuit design book using Keysight EDA’s Advanced Design System software. The book was written by Dr. Kyung-Whan Yeom, professor in CNU’s department of radio science and engineering and a Keysight Certified Expert. The book is a compilation of Dr. Yeom’s studies and insights from his 20 years of expertise using ADS design software.
